- The Big Secret to Creating Wealth -

The big secret really isn't a secret. Many of you will read this big secret and think to yourself, "Of course! I know that! Tell me something I don't know!"

The big secret to creating wealth is...take action now!

If you did something every day to positively impact your wealth, how much wealth could you build in the next 30 days? In the next 60 days? In the next year?

And while many people know this big secret, very few actually follow it.

- Are You A Statistic? -

While many people know this big secret, very few actually follow it.

I have been speaking at several seminars lately. The people I'm presenting to are people who have chosen to be there and have often paid hundreds, if not thousands, of dollars to be there. Yet, the statistics are shocking about who actually takes action and does something to change their financial position!

Less than 5% of people who attend educational seminars actually take action.

It's not just seminar related, less than 8% of those who set new years resolutions actually achieve them.

Will you fall into the minority that takes action now or will you fall into the majority and put it on the back burner?
